About the Flag

It is a typical Portuguese communal flag, with the coat of arms centred on a field gyronny of eight of white and blue.

Coat of arms

Shield Argent with base wavy of Azure and Argent, issuant from base a bridge Argent masoned Sable with two arches, in chief a hurt charged with a radiant sun Or, flanked by two branches of privet Proper, the dexter one blossomed, the sinister one fruited. Mural crown Argent with five visible towers (city rank) and white scroll with inscription in black capitals "CIDADE DE ALFENA".
Meaning:
The silver colour of the shield is symbolizing hope and is referring to mining in the past of Alfena. The privet branches (Latin: Arbusto oleáceo / Port.: alfena) are canting elements, furthermore the 21 berries of the sinister one are representing the 21 settlements of the city. The bridge is simbolizing Lazarus Bridge (Ponte de S. Lázaro) crossing Leçça River, which is sinmbolized by the base wavy. The sun is simbolizing eternity, while the hurt, a blue disc is simbolizing the universe, and fidelity, joy and nobility as well.

Previous Flag

[Alfena town flag] 2:3 image by Sérgio Horta, 1 Feb 2017

The previous symbols had been nealy the same as current ones but the flag was quartered of blue and white with mural crown having just four visible towers (town rank) and inscription "VILA DE ALFENA".

Presentation of Alfena

Alfena Commune is one of the four communes of Valongo Municipality; it had 15 211 inhabitants in 2011 and covers 15.7 km². On 6 April 2011 Alfena was upgraded to a city.
